Description
We are seeking a knowledgeable and engaging Freelance Biology Teacher to support high school students in understanding biological concepts and preparing for examinations. The role includes teaching topics such as human anatomy, genetics, ecology, and plant physiology.
The teacher will deliver interactive lessons, guide students through practical-based understanding (including simulations where necessary), and assist in revision and exam preparation. Emphasis will be placed on helping students relate theoretical knowledge to real-life applications.
The ideal candidate should be enthusiastic about science education and capable of making biology interesting and easy to understand.

Requirements
Bachelor’s Degree in Education (Biology) or related field
TSC registration
Minimum of 2 years teaching experience in secondary school
Strong understanding of KCSE Biology syllabus
Ability to simplify scientific concepts
Experience with practical teaching or lab-based instruction
Good communication and student engagement skills
Ability to teach online or in hybrid settings
Passion for science and student mentorship
